import { isValid, parseISO } from 'date-fns' import { emptyCombinationRule, ruleValueNumberTypes } from '../constants' import { ICategoryConfiguration, IOperatorsValueType, IParsedCategoryConfiguration, IRule, IRuleAttribute, IRuleCombination, IRuleEngineOperators, RuleAttributeType, RuleType, RuleValueType, } from '../types' export function isCombinationRule(rule: IRule): rule is IRuleCombination { return rule.type === RuleType.COMBINATION } export function isAttributeRule(rule: IRule): rule is IRuleAttribute { return rule.type === RuleType.ATTRIBUTE } export function getAttributeRuleValueType( rule: IRuleAttribute, operatorsValueType: IOperatorsValueType ): RuleValueType { return operatorsValueType[rule.attribute_type]?.[rule.operator] } export function isAttributeRuleValueMultiple( valueType: RuleValueType ): boolean { return valueType?.startsWith('[') && valueType?.endsWith(']') } export function parseRule<R extends IRule>(rule: R): R { if (isCombinationRule(rule)) { return { ...rule, value: rule.value === 'true', children: rule.children.map((rule) => parseRule(rule)), } } return rule } export function parseCatConf( catConf: ICategoryConfiguration ): IParsedCategoryConfiguration { let virtualRule: IRuleCombination try { virtualRule = parseRule(JSON.parse(catConf.virtualRule)) } catch { virtualRule = emptyCombinationRule } return { ...catConf, virtualRule } } export function serializeRule<R extends IRule>( rule: R, ruleOperators?: IRuleEngineOperators ): R { if (isCombinationRule(rule)) { return { ...rule, value: String(rule.value), children: rule.children.map((rule) => serializeRule(rule, ruleOperators)), } } else if (isAttributeRule(rule)) { let ruleValue: string | string[] | number | number[] | boolean | Date = rule.value const valueType = getAttributeRuleValueType( rule, ruleOperators.operatorsValueType ) if ( isAttributeRuleValueMultiple(valueType) && rule.value instanceof Array ) { if ( ruleValueNumberTypes.includes(valueType.slice(1, -1) as RuleValueType) ) { ruleValue = rule.value.map(Number) } else { ruleValue = rule.value.map(String) } } else if (ruleValueNumberTypes.includes(valueType)) { ruleValue = Number(rule.value) } else if ( (RuleAttributeType.DATE || RuleAttributeType.DATETIME) && ruleValue instanceof Date ) { if (isValid(ruleValue)) { // We have no datetime rule attribute for now, so it would always be Date ruleValue = rule.attribute_type === RuleAttributeType.DATE ? ruleValue.toISOString().split('T')[0] : ruleValue.toISOString() } } else if (valueType === RuleValueType.STRING) { ruleValue = String(rule.value) } return { ...rule, value: ruleValue } } return rule } export function serializeCatConf( catConf: IParsedCategoryConfiguration, ruleOperators?: IRuleEngineOperators ): ICategoryConfiguration { if (!catConf.virtualRule) { return catConf as Omit<IParsedCategoryConfiguration, 'virtualRule'> } return { ...catConf, virtualRule: JSON.stringify( serializeRule(catConf.virtualRule, ruleOperators) ), } } export function cleanBeforeSaveCatConf( catConf: ICategoryConfiguration | IParsedCategoryConfiguration ): ICategoryConfiguration | IParsedCategoryConfiguration { const catConfCleaned = { ...catConf } if (!catConf.id) { delete catConfCleaned['@id'] delete catConfCleaned.id } return catConfCleaned } function isDateValueValid(value: string | Date): boolean { // TODO: our version date-fns isValid only accepts dates not strings // Update to date-fns >= 3 which accepts both formats return isValid(value instanceof Date ? value : parseISO(value)) } // TODO: refactor this validation with the ResourceForm one export function isRuleValid(rule?: IRule): boolean { if (!rule) { return true } else if (isCombinationRule(rule)) { return rule.children.every(isRuleValid) } else if (isAttributeRule(rule)) { // TODO: implement a more generic solution if more attributes rules // require specific validations const isRuleValueValid = rule.attribute_type === RuleAttributeType.DATE ? isDateValueValid(rule.value as string | Date) : rule.value !== '' return rule.field !== '' && rule.operator !== '' && isRuleValueValid } return true }
